La Crosse, Indiana Climate Data

La Crosse, Indiana has a Humid Continental Hot Summers With Year Around Precipitation climate (Köppen classification: Dfa). Average annual temperatures range from 4.2 °C (low) to 15.5 °C (high). Annual precipitation averages 1023.6 Millimeters. La Crosse is located in USDA Plant Hardiness Zone 5b. The growing season typically runs from the last frost around Apr. 21 - Apr. 30 through the first frost around Oct. 11 - Oct. 20.

Monthly Average Climate Data for La Crosse, Indiana

Average monthly temperatures and precipitation Switch to Fahrenheit
MonthAvg. LowAvg. HighAvg. Precip
January-9.1 °C0 °C60.96 mm
February-7.5 °C2.2 °C54.36 mm
March-2.7 °C8.4 °C62.74 mm
April3.1 °C15.5 °C92.2 mm
May9.7 °C21.7 °C106.68 mm
June15.1 °C26.8 °C114.3 mm
July16.5 °C28.5 °C116.33 mm
August15.4 °C27.6 °C108.2 mm
September11.2 °C24.6 °C86.87 mm
October5 °C17.7 °C90.68 mm
November-0.6 °C9.6 °C71.63 mm
December-5.7 °C2.9 °C58.67 mm
Annual4.2 °C15.5 °C1023.62 mm
